The Bank was registered in 1913 and started formal functioning from 1914. Puttur was the first registered office of the bank subsequently it was shifted to Mangalore. The Bank is having 53 Branches including service Branch spreading over the undivided South Canara District at Mangalore.

The Bank is giving top priority for financing Agricultural sector since inception, taking into consideration of various credit needs of the farmers. The Bank is striving to provide timely and adequate finance through the primary Agriculture Societies at the ground level. The bank is taking active participation in Government sponsored schemes such as S.G.S.Y, Swarojgar Credit Card Scheme etc.

The bank has issued 58516 Mangala Kissan Credit Cards to the members of the PACS and out of which 46332 Members have been covered under personal accident insurance schemes. A scheme of Rs. 296.92 crores has been advanced under this scheme during the year 2007-08. The Borrower of the crop loans are also covered by the crop insurance of the Government. With a view to diversify the activities Bank is also financing to non-farm sector since there is scope for financing under non form sector in both the Districts.
 
Bank has provided financial support to the sugar industry under consortium arrangement and advanced Rs. 38.35 crores to 10 sugar factories in various districts of the state of Karnataka

The Bank has taken active participation in the promotion and financing the Self Help Groups. The Bank has promoted 32720 SHG groups under the supervision of the Navodaya Grama Vikasa Charitable Trust (R), Mangalore.

The Bank has bagged State Level Awards for best performance of SHGs from NABARD since 8 years. The SHG groups have mobilized           Rs. 33.94 crores as savings and 19510 groups are credit linked by the Bank and Rs. 71.81 crores loans advanced to them.
 
The Bank has not lagged behind in customer service. All the Branches are fully computerized. The Bank has introduced several innovative service activities like Single Window System, Any Branch Banking and ATM facilities etc.

The Bank is having ATM at Mangalore and Udupi. 12 hours of Banking from 8AM to 8PM is also available at Kodialbail Branch.

The Bank has introduced Mobile Banking – A Bank on Wheels to facilitate Banking Services to the rural population, where there is no Bank Branches. The customer can avail all banking transactions such as deposits, withdrawal and loan facility. The Mobile Bank is inter connected with all Branches of the Bank through Any Branch Banking facility.

The Bank has mobilized Rs.671.00 crores of Deposit as on               31-03-2008 and loan outstanding Rs.557 crores, out of which Rs. 247.98 crores as S.T. Agricultural and Rs. 62.57 crores as M.T. Agricultural. The Bank Advances loans to various purposes as per needs of the borrower such as loan to vehicle purchase, housing, commercial complex, pledging of jewels and loan to purchase consumer durables and also for agricultural land purchase.

The Management of the Bank is vested with Board of Directors consisting of 14 members under the president ship of the veteran              Co-operator Sri M. N. Rajendra Kumar, who is also the President of Karnataka State Co-operative Apex Bank.

Our Bank has bagged Best performance Award from KSC Bank since last 12 years.
